There is another method to delete an FB account, I think a little safer.
At the top right you click the down arrow, there you have "Settings" in the list, closer to the bottom than the top.
In the settings you select the option Account management.
And there you have two options:
- "Ask for account deletion"
- Deactivate the account
Deactivation allows you to activate your account in the future, and deleting it will not, unless you change your mind quickly, maybe your account will not be deleted yet.

To delete your Facebook account, follow these steps:
1. Log in to your Facebook account.
2. Click on the down arrow in the upper right corner of the page, then select "Settings & Privacy" and then "Settings".
3. In the left menu, click "Your Facebook Information".
4. Click "Delete account and information" and then "Submit".
5. Enter your password, click "Continue" and then "Delete account".
Please note that the account deletion process is irreversible after 30 days. If you log into your Facebook account within these 30 days, the removal process will be cancelled.
